## Local Setup

Before running the Quillbus broker locally, you need the compaction service working. Log compaction in Quillbus periodically collapses segment files, keeping only the latest record per key. The compactor tracks segment offsets in a small Postgres database, so new team members must provision it first. Point the compactor at this database using the connection string below.

warehouse DSN: mssql://rusdor_svc:0FSWCn9@db-951a.paliqforge.local:5432/ulawyn

# Data Stores — Fernwick CSV Import Wizard

The wizard stages uploads in `import_staging`, validates rows, then commits to the main catalog schema. Staging rows purge after 72 hours. Failed batches land in `import_rejects` with error codes. Releases must run the schema check job before deploy; a mismatch blocks the pipeline. Rollbacks only affect staging, never the catalog. Capacity is sized for 500k rows per batch. The wizard's staging database is reached via the following connection string.

replica DSN, yahaf-yagaf: mongodb://tamath_svc:a2netSk3RZMuTj@db-d084.novacsoft.internal:5432/ralmir

User-supplied formulas in the Pricing module triggered the sandbox violation counter above threshold. Evaluation is now failing closed: affected customers will see "formula blocked" errors instead of results. This is expected behavior, not data loss. Do not advise customers to re-enter formulas; the evaluator will retry once the Calcine sandbox pool recycles. Escalate only if errors persist past 30 minutes or span multiple tenants. Full triage steps and customer messaging are on the internal page below.

wiki page, yaweg-tawep: https://vault.nelvrotech.local/board/secrets/build/build/dash/run/job/3557e844d3f4d283dcee17aa

**Flaky DNS in Driftgate Session Service**

Every few weeks the Driftgate session nodes in the Ombral region start timing out on lookups for the token-mint host. It's the resolver cache going stale after a failover, not the service itself. Quick check: run `driftctl dns-probe` from the bastion; if more than 5% of probes fail, restart `cachedns` on the affected nodes. Sessions recover within two minutes — don't drain the pool. To run the probe against the internal resolver API, authenticate with the token below.

portal login ticket: eyJhbGciOiJIUzI1NiIsInR5cCI6IkpXVCJ9.eyJzdWIiOiIwEOsktwVNwIn0.-UJU3fdyyCgG